The benefits of using white space on landing pages

White space, also known as negative space, is the area on a page that is left blank, unoccupied and free from any elements or design elements. It might seem like a waste of precious real estate on a landing page, but in reality, it's quite the opposite. In fact, using white space effectively can greatly enhance the user experience, improve the overall design and increase conversions.

The importance of trust signals on landing pages

When it comes to making a purchase online, the first thing that comes to mind is trust. Will this website keep my information safe? Is this product actually going to deliver what it promises? These are just a few of the many questions that go through a customer's mind before they hit the buy button.

And that's where trust signals come in. Trust signals are elements on a landing page that help build trust with potential customers and give them the confidence to complete a purchase.
